We are heading north from Galway through coastal Connemara and on to Donegal in early May for a week and would like to stay flexible with our itinerary. Can anyone tell us - will we have decent options if we call ahead a few days before at this time of year?

I'm not making you any guarantee, but if it were my trip, I'd go ahead with that plan. It may depend on your definition of "decent options." I also assume you're a couple and don't need any special type of room. Expect weekends to be busier, especially if the weather forecast is good.

Monday 6 May is a Bank Holiday here, so a lot of hotels will be busy the 4th/5th for weekend and family breaks.

Midweek you should be fine.

I've booked many times on the morning before I arrive and always been able to find a place. There are plenty of decent places all over Ireland that don't need much prior notice.

Probably the biggest exceptions to that are if there is a place you have your heart set on staying. If so, you should probably book that ahead.

I also book ahead for any fixed portions of my trip. I know when I'm flying in, so a place for that night saves mental wear and tear on my jet lag day. I know when I'm flying out so I'll plan to be near the airport the night before. Train tickets or booked activities can also "fix" a portion of your trip.
